C.O.M.E.T.S. is a program designed to enable Olin community members (staff, faculty, parents, students, alumni or family members) to recognize faculty, staff or other mentors/educators that have helped make a student or colleague's experience here at Olin an exceptional one.
C.O.M.E.T.S. stands for Celebrate Olin Mentors, Engineers, Teachers & Staff.

A C.O.M.E.T.S. recognition allows you to indicate your award amount and write a short description honoring the person to whom you are dedicating your award. The recipient will be presented with a formal certificate indicating your name and reason behind your award. You can recognize as many people as you wish by selecting the quantity of C.O.M.E.T.S. on the give a C.O.M.E.T.S. page. For your convenience, you will only have to provide your payment information once. The amount of your gift is confidential; thus, the recipient will not know the level of support you have chosen.
